This book is a comprehensive investigation into the history of medieval book curses, which were written by scribes in order to protect their manuscripts from theft or damage. These curses, often written in Latin, were believed to possess mystical powers that could deter would-be thieves or prevent readers from causing harm to the manuscript.

The author provides a detailed analysis of numerous examples of book curses, drawn from a variety of manuscripts and archival sources. Through these examples, he explores the various motivations and intentions behind the use of book curses, including a desire to protect valuable books, to prevent unauthorized copying, and to assert ownership and authority over the text.

The book also delves into the broader cultural context in which book curses were used. It explores the role of the medieval church and the political and social circumstances of the time, and shows how book curses reflect wider cultural trends and beliefs. In addition, it discusses the fascinating linguistic and calligraphic features of book curses, and how these can provide valuable insights into the scribes who wrote them and the audiences they were aimed at.
